Cyborg
The merging of man and machine, cyborgs are all humans that have enhanced themselves in some way. Whether due to injury, choice, or experimentation, Cyborgs have become a cut above the regular person. With augmentations and abilities as wide ranging as the minds that made them, no two Cyborgs are alike.

Still human: effects that target humans still affect Cyborgs, as they still technically are. exceptions are when the Cyborg’s modifications obviously make him immune.

Cybernetics and enhancements: Every Cyborg must have some (exact number tbd) of these, as they are the defining feature. They also must be extensive or somehow extreme. a replaced limb will not cut it (no matter how fancy the prosthetic is), though full wiring to the brain with HUD’s and such would. You do have a lot of freedom in this aspect, but try not to go overboard.

Powersource: Everything needs energy to work. while some extremely small things may not need a specific source (Powering a single micro circuit could theoretically be done off the nervous systems pulses), most Cyborgs have too large or too many to rely on that. Electricity, steam, diesel, solar, etc. are all valid sources, but remember their drawbacks. How is he getting the electricity, where is the boiler for the steam or the combustion engine for diesel, where are the panels stored (keep in mind their size. portable ones work for phones, but a cyborg isn’t a phone), etc. This is fantasy, so you have some leeway, but it still needs explanation.

Mentality: Having parts of your body replaced with cybernetics does not have a very positive effect on the brain. Trauma from the accident that forced the enhancements, shock from being forcibly experimented on, or crazy enough to think it was a good idea, every cyborg has something whacked about them and it should be reflected in personality.

Elves
The strange elements brought to Earth by the meteor impacts affected some people differently than others. Some gained magic ike abilities, others grew twisted yet still remained primarily human. The beings now referred to as the elves are almost a mix. Almost mutated in exactly the same way, Elves have acquired what can be described as an expanded mind, as well as hyper reflexes and an affinity to magic.

No longer human: Things that specifically target humans cannot effect elves, they are just too different, even genetically.

Expanded mind: Elves primary change is in their brains, expanding to new horizons and thought patterns. this should be reflected in their personalities.

Hyperactive Reflex: Elves have extremely fast reflexes, enabling them to dodge certain things better, and aim weapons faster. This makes them have a better use of evasion and similar skills, as well as dexterity based fighting.

Magic Affinity: due to the mutations they have experienced, elves have a slight immunity to the effects of magic. They do not go as crazy as fast, and get one free rank in their first magic based class. (any hybrid or Mage)

Mutants
Various dusts, carcinogens, and strange new elements had gotten into the air due to the impacts and these have had many effects on the people who had breathed them. Most died, some just got sick, and others were unaffected. A very small few noticed that they or their children were just slightly off. Mutants are these humans that have had some aspect of them changed.

No longer Human: Effects that target only humans does not affect them.

Mutation: the primary aspect that defines them, most have one significant aspect about them changed (maybe two, but ask for permission first). Feel free to get creative with these, but keep them within reason, as much as mutants can be.

Messed up: Due to the various chemicals/elements that causes these mutations, and the mutations themselves, a Mutants psyc will be worse than most. That being said, having already been exposed to high amounts, they have almost no negative effects when encountering more.
